Environment:Debian 12, vmware, 8 vCPU, 16 GB RAM, vSphere 7.0.3.01900
Steps to reproduce:
- Add vSphere via Zabbix Template 'VMware' (out-of-box from Zabbix)
- Configure the needed Macros, {$VMWARE.URL}, {$VMWARE.USERNAME}, {$VMWARE.PASSWORD}
- Select Monitored by Proxy
Result:
Every few minutes, the Zabbix proxy service crashes with the message “Got signal [signal:11(SIGSEGV),reason:1,refaddr:0x60]. Crashing ...” from the vmware collector.
See log file zabbix_proxy.log.gz
Expected:
No crash at all.
What have I tried:
Increase vmwarefrequency to 120, vmwareperffrequency to 60 and startvmwarecollectors from 5 to 10.
Additional Information:
The zabbix proxy 'monproxy1-1.infra.sgg1.ch.abainfra.net' monitors 3 vSpheres. The second proxy 'monproxy1-1.infra.gtg1.ch.abainfra.net' only one. The problem shows only on 'monproxy1-1.infra.sgg1.ch.abainfra.net'. Configuration are the same, I deploy it via Puppet.
